Raylenth Posted June 11, 2017 Share Posted June 11, 2017 I'm not sure what you are doing incorrectly Dalek, maybe read this http://support.photobucket.com/hc/en-us/articles/200724424-Linking-to-Forums the last section on Direct. But basically if you have successfully uploaded the image to PBucket go to your library and mouse over the image, 3 vertical lines appear in the top left corner of the picture, mouse over that and a drop down menu appears, click on 'share' and in the box that pops up click on the Direct dialogue box, right click and copy it. Then on here, as before click on the Insert Other Media box, Insert from URL and just click in the box and paste it - you don't have to delete the example that's already in the dialogue box.
